我们正在使用RHEL5.3与一个克拉里翁SAN附在FC。
我们的情况是,我们有许多LUN呈现给主机,我们希望动态地向Xen客人呈现LUN。我们不知道什么是最佳实践方法来设置这一点。Xen来宾将组成一个集群,并且只需要用于数据分区的LUN,即当他们正在积极运行服务时。
因此,一种方法是始终将所有磁盘呈现给所有Xen客户,然后依赖于集群软件,并挂载自己,不要在两个位置安装磁盘两次。这听起来有点冒险,而且也不是很安全(一个有漏洞的客人可以看到/销毁所有的数据)。
另一种方法是在dom0级别(使用xm块附加)动态地从Xen来宾中添加和删除磁盘。这可能会工作,但听起来有点复杂,我想知道Red集群套件是否在某种程度上支持这一点,或者是否有脚本可以这样做。
另一种方法是将LUN端指向Xen来宾自己--我不确定这在技术上是否可行,因为multipathing必须在主机级别完成。
发布于 2011-05-18 20:31:04
我也有同样的问题。我的回答是把隆斯介绍给所有的主人,并让多马斯控制他们的进入。
更好的方法可能是在DomUs上运行集群-lvm。( RH上的/etc/lvm/lvm.conf locking_type=3应该能做到这一点)。在此之后,将所有LUN呈现给所有DomUs,根据需要从DomU中创建PVs、VGs和LV。
如果您不需要在相同的LUN上同时访问,我不会选择gfs或ocfs。
发布于 2010-04-21 02:59:28
您考虑过像政府财政这样的集群文件系统吗?
https://serverfault.com/questions/134269
复制相似问题